The Fresh Market at Arboretum Village closed this past May after about a year and a half in business, but it won’t be vacant much longer.

Three shuttered Fresh Market stores in the Dallas market, including the one in our neighborhood, will become Tom Thumb stores. Albertson’s, the parent company of Tom Thumb, announced Wednesday that it is buying the three Fresh Market stores that closed here in May; the other two are in Turtle Creek and Fort Worth’s University District.

The Dallas Morning News reports that Albertson’s completed the purchase of Tom Thumb at the beginning of this year and “seems to be favoring the Tom Thumb brand in North Texas.”

The former Albertson’s store at Mockingbird and Abrams became a Minyard’s Sun Fresh Market in February 2015. That store closed Sept. 1 and now is set to become an H-E-B Central Market.
